1. 03 May, 2022 1 commit
  2. 02 May, 2022 8 commits
  3. 28 Apr, 2022 6 commits
  4. 27 Apr, 2022 2 commits
    • I Patini's avatar
      EMS: Web Admin, Baguette Client, Control Service: Made functional the client &... · 211a5bf0
      I Patini authored
      EMS: Web Admin, Baguette Client, Control Service: Made functional the client & cluster statistics in Web Admin topology section. Moved 'SystemResourceMonitor' class from control service (info service) to 'common' package to become available to baguette-client. Improved 'sysmon.sh' script to report current date/time and uptime, and it is also bundled with EMS clients. Extended EMS client to include 'sysmon.sh' data in client statistics sent to EMS server (through SystemResourceMonitor)
      211a5bf0
    • I Patini's avatar
      EMS: Baguette Server, Baguette Client, Control Service: Changed client... · 42544db1
      I Patini authored
      EMS: Baguette Server, Baguette Client, Control Service: Changed client Statistics collection from PULL (by server) to PUSH. Each EMS client periodically sends its statistics to EMS server.
      42544db1
  5. 20 Apr, 2022 1 commit
    • ipatini's avatar
      EMS: Control Service: Added One-Time-Password (OTP) authentication in... · 1d3cd48b
      ipatini authored
      EMS: Control Service: Added One-Time-Password (OTP) authentication in WebSecurityConfig; also added endpoints for creating/removing OTPs. Made JWT request parameter configurable (defaults to null for security). Minor improvements and typo corrections in WebSecurityConfig.
      1d3cd48b
  6. 19 Apr, 2022 1 commit
  7. 17 Apr, 2022 2 commits
  8. 16 Apr, 2022 2 commits
  9. 15 Apr, 2022 1 commit
  10. 13 Apr, 2022 2 commits
  11. 12 Apr, 2022 3 commits
  12. 11 Apr, 2022 2 commits
  13. 10 Apr, 2022 1 commit
  14. 09 Apr, 2022 5 commits
    • ipatini's avatar
      EMS: Control Service, pom.xml: Changed profile 'dev-docker-image-build' in... · b9d69c5b
      ipatini authored
      EMS: Control Service, pom.xml: Changed profile 'dev-docker-image-build' in 'control-service/pom.xml', to get activated when file '.dev-local-docker-image-build' exists at top-level EMS folder (not in control-service folder). Changed profile '.dev-skip-build-web-admin' in top-level 'pom.xml' to get activated when when file '.dev-skip-build-web-admin' does *NOT* exist in top-level EMS folder.
      b9d69c5b
    • ipatini's avatar
      EMS: Control Service, Baguette Client Install: Changed JRE8 installation... · 77b20fd7
      ipatini authored
      EMS: Control Service, Baguette Client Install: Changed JRE8 installation instruction set to download JRE8 from EMS server. Fixed instruction set placeholder processing to trim the ending '/' from BASE_URL and DOWNLOAD_URL variables.
      77b20fd7
    • ipatini's avatar
      EMS: Control Service: Improved profile 'dev-docker-image-build' in pom.xml, to... · f44b594c
      ipatini authored
      EMS: Control Service: Improved profile 'dev-docker-image-build' in pom.xml, to get activated when file 'control-service/.dev-local-docker-image-build' exists.
      f44b594c
    • ipatini's avatar
      EMS: Control Service: Added new profile 'dev-docker-image-build' in 'pom.xml'... · 3b30e073
      ipatini authored
      EMS: Control Service: Added new profile 'dev-docker-image-build' in 'pom.xml' used for local docker image builds. It turns off the old 'com.spotify:docker-maven-plugin' and uses 'io.fabric8:docker-maven-plugin' instead. Few other improvements.
      3b30e073
    • ipatini's avatar
      EMS: Broker-CEP: Added queuing and retrying, for event publishing to local... · e0cc4d02
      ipatini authored
      EMS: Broker-CEP: Added queuing and retrying, for event publishing to local broker and event forwarding to the next groupings. This applies to generated events captured by 'BrokerCepStatementSubscriber' instances. By default, failed publish/forward attempts will be repeated forever. A retry limit (num. of retries or max retry duration) can be set in 'eu.melodic.event.brokercep.properties' by setting either 'brokercep.max-event-forward-retries' or 'brokercep.max-event-forward-duration' (in millis).
      e0cc4d02
  15. 08 Apr, 2022 3 commits
    • ipatini's avatar
      EMS: Broker-CEP, config-files: Changed 'brokerUrl' field in... · fc4d2839
      ipatini authored
      EMS: Broker-CEP, config-files: Changed 'brokerUrl' field in 'BrokerCepProperties' class (i.e. 'brokercep.broker-url' property), into List of broker connector URLs (the 1st is the main connector). Removed 'brokerUrlProperties' and 'clientAuthRequired' properties and related code (they were appended to the main connnector URL). Removed unneeded fields 'defaultIpAddress' and 'publicIpAddress'. Extended 'BrokerConfig' class to initialize all connectors in 'brokerUrl' (not only the main and 2 additional as before). Connectors can arbitrarily be either SSL or non-SSL. Updated configuration files (eu.melodic.event.brokercep.properties).
      fc4d2839
    • ipatini's avatar
      EMS: Broker-CEP, Util: Removed code related to replacing occurrences of... · 86aae474
      ipatini authored
      EMS: Broker-CEP, Util: Removed code related to replacing occurrences of '%{DEFAULT_IP/PUBLIC_IP}%' to their actual values. Removed unused methods from 'IKeystoreAndCertificateProperties' and 'KeystoreAndCertificateProperties'. Few minor code improvements.
      86aae474
    • ipatini's avatar
      EMS: Baguette Client Install: Removed occurrences of... · e5b36bce
      ipatini authored
      EMS: Baguette Client Install: Removed occurrences of '%{DEFAULT_IP/PUBLIC_IP}%' from AbstractInstallationHelper class
      e5b36bce